Output 8511018b6091ac6c2e7588b7f058aadb41c2a532909b09f9a5570f06f3510939:1

value
5768671
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45854e90dae92c4780b00d256433e2c5c955fc14 OP_EQUALVERIFY OP_CHECKSIG
address
17LbKZbMx7YvTVdrRr1so6fNr7qbxfbkcg
transaction
8511018b6091ac6c2e7588b7f058aadb41c2a532909b09f9a5570f06f3510939
spent
true